1. Sturdy Ladder

A reliable ladder is the foundation of safe gutter cleaning. Choose a ladder that is tall enough to reach your gutters without stretching, and ensure it has a non-slip base for stability. For multi-story homes, consider an extension ladder. Always follow ladder safety guidelines to avoid accidents while performing Gutter Cleaning Macclesfield.

2. Gutter Scoop or Trowel

Once you have access to your gutters, a gutter scoop or small trowel is essential for removing leaves, twigs, and debris. A scoop allows you to efficiently collect debris without damaging your gutters. Some scoops are designed with a curve to fit the gutter’s shape, making the job faster and more thorough.

3. Garden Hose with Spray Nozzle

After removing large debris, a garden hose with an adjustable spray nozzle is invaluable for flushing out remaining dirt and checking for leaks. High-pressure water can help dislodge stubborn dirt and ensure that downspouts are clear. Using a hose also allows you to spot any areas that may need minor repairs, keeping your Gutter Cleaning Macclesfield efficient.

4. Safety Gloves and Protective Gear

Gutter cleaning involves handling sharp leaves, sticks, and sometimes even pests. Protective gloves are essential to prevent cuts and scratches. Safety goggles and a long-sleeve shirt can protect your eyes and skin from debris and water. Proper protective gear ensures your gutter cleaning experience is safe and stress-free.

5. Gutter Cleaning Tools for Hard-to-Reach Areas

For homes with difficult-to-access gutters, specialized tools such as telescopic gutter cleaning poles or gutter vacuums can be extremely helpful. These tools allow you to clean from the ground without needing to climb onto a ladder, adding a layer of safety while still performing thorough Gutter Cleaning Macclesfield.

6. Downspout Cleaner or Plumbing Snake

Sometimes, downspouts get clogged with stubborn debris. A downspout cleaner, plumbing snake, or flexible brush can help clear blockages effectively. Ensuring your downspouts are fully functional prevents water overflow and protects your home’s foundation.

7. Trash Bags or Buckets

Finally, you’ll need a way to collect and dispose of debris efficiently. Use trash bags or buckets to gather leaves and other waste from your gutters. This keeps your work area clean and allows for easy disposal after completing Gutter Cleaning Macclesfield.
